French musician Cecilé Schott performs under the name Colleen and will be releasing her seventh album, The Tunnel and the Clearing, May 21 on Thrill Jockey. Schott typically chooses a limited instrumental palette for all of her albums an this one is no different, using a handful of analog electronic instruments and effects alongside her vocals.
